does the correlation in the situation illustrate causation? the value of a collectible plate decreases as the number of plates produced increases. a) no, a decrease in the value of a collectible plate likely does not cause more plates to be produced. b) no, producing more collectible plates likely does not cause the value of the plate to decrease. c) yes, a decrease in the value of a collectible plate likely causes more plates to be produced. d) yes, producing more collectible plates likely causes the value of the plate to decrease.

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

Correlation does not always imply causation. In this case, when the number of collectible plates produced increases, the value of the plate decreases. This is a classic supply - and - demand relationship. When supply (number of plates produced) increases, ceteris paribus (all other things being equal), the value (price) of the item decreases. So, producing more plates (increase in supply) causes the value to decrease.

Answer:

D. Yes, producing more collectible plates likely causes the value of the plate to decrease.
